Repeaters in lower secondary general education, all grades, male in Cambodia
Cambodia: Repeaters in lower secondary general education, all grades, male was 11,249 in 2024. ▼ Falling
Repeaters in lower secondary general education, all grades, male in Cambodia, 1997–2024
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ics.
Analysis
In 2024, repeaters in lower secondary general education, all grades, male in Cambodia stood at 11,249.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 19.4% on the previous year and up 111.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, repeaters in lower secondary general education, all grades, male in Cambodia peaked at 20,847 in 1997 and was at its lowest, 1,899, in 2021.
That places Cambodia 66th out of 191 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 25 years of available data.
Repeaters in lower secondary general education, all grades, male in Cambodia,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 1997 | 20,847 | — |
| 1999 | 14,598 | -30.0% |
| 2001 | 3,911 | -73.2% |
| 2002 | 7,992 | +104.3% |
| 2003 | 14,042 | +75.7% |
| 2004 | 13,786 | -1.8% |
| 2005 | 14,869 | +7.9% |
| 2006 | 10,305 | -30.7% |
| 2007 | 10,584 | +2.7% |
| 2008 | 8,964 | -15.3% |
| 2010 | 9,760 | +8.9% |
| 2011 | 8,071 | -17.3% |
| 2012 | 6,790 | -15.9% |
| 2013 | 5,204 | -23.4% |
| 2014 | 5,331 | +2.4% |
| 2015 | 6,744 | +26.5% |
| 2016 | 8,583 | +27.3% |
| 2017 | 9,464 | +10.3% |
| 2018 | 10,403 | +9.9% |
| 2019 | 10,577 | +1.7% |
| 2020 | 11,944 | +12.9% |
| 2021 | 1,899 | -84.1% |
| 2022 | 5,063 | +166.6% |
| 2023 | 9,422 | +86.1% |
| 2024 | 11,249 | +19.4% |
